Opaque Envelope Basis of Designs

Developed to be IBC 2018, IECC 2018 and NFPA 285 Compliant (where indicated) for Climate Zones 5 & 6

The following opaque envelope wall Basis of Design (BOD) packages have been developed to assist owners, architects and contractors in the selection, specification and detailing of exterior wall assemblies that are code compliant, and based on building science fundamentals.  Assemblies in the wall BODs strive for the concept of the Perfect Wall and are recommended to meet the requirements of the IBC 2018, IECC 2018 (Climate Zones 5 & 6), NFPA 285 acceptance criteria when applicable, and LEED v4 Fundamental Commissioning requirements for exterior wall assemblies.  Dew point analysis are based on ASHRAE 99% winter outdoor design conditions for the greater Boston area and best practice indoor design conditions for typical uses.  Appropriate use and application of the assemblies illustrated in these BODs will vary based on performance considerations and environmental conditions unique to each project and, therefore, do not represent the final opinion or recommendation of PACE Representatives or represented manufacturers.  Contact PACE Representatives to develop a custom wall BOD package to meet your project specific performance requirements and design conditions.

*NFPA 285 compliance for assemblies is demonstrated using one or more manufacturer's third-party NFPA 285 engineering evaluation(s) per IBC Section 104.11 Alternative Materials, Designs and Methods of Construction and Equipment.
